Microbiology control testing simplified with one-step method

Stratix Labs has unveiled Instant Inoculator QC microorganisms, a ready-to-use product that delivers reference microorganisms to solid media with a simple one-step method.

Each device comes individually sealed with authentic reference microorganisms coated and preserved on the applicator region.

Using a patent-pending technology, the Instant Inoculator directly transfers isolated colonies to solid media. It requires no preparation, no rehydration, and no liquid handling. Simply spread the Instant Inoculator on solid media for 5-10 seconds to deliver an ideal spread of isolated colonies.

Instant Inoculator is designed for use with solid media, including traditional agar plates as well as alternative systems such as dry sheet media for culturing microorganisms. Various reference strains are available in the Instant Inoculator format and Stratix Labs is rapidly expanding the list of available strains.
